Output 695d229ffd69435e209a6bc508baad6b22f0215bb67a30f75a5930c158f1e7a0:2

value
996455
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2ca24829c2f3fff7c44b54a24e4659b25309922 OP_EQUAL
address
3NNAo1h9bmsCDnkpKzS7QYY2tDkjRxQKcS
transaction
695d229ffd69435e209a6bc508baad6b22f0215bb67a30f75a5930c158f1e7a0
spent
true